- Title
Medusaegraptus (Chlorophyta, Dasycladales) from the Pridolian to middle Lochkovian Indian Point Formation, New Brunswick, Canada.
- Authors
LODUCA, STEVEN T.; MILLER, RANDALL F.; WILSON, REGINALD A.
- Abstract
Carbonaceous compressions from the Pridolian to middle Lochkovian Indian Point Formation in the Flatlands area of New Brunswick comprising a central axis with irregularly arranged unbranched appendages are assigned to Medusaegraptus mirabilis. This is the first report of intact thalli of this noncalcified macroalgal taxon from a locality outside of western New York. The biotic composition, stratigraphic context, and sedimentology of this occurrence suggest a shallow-marine depositional setting roughly comparable to that for the type material of Medusaegraptus mirabilis from Gasport, New York.
